摘要

In resent years, DC Power Supply System was used for a Demonstrative Project on Power Supply in Telecommunications Facilities in data center[1]. There are many merit of using DC Power Supply such as highly efficient etc. Telecommunications Facilities in data center is requested for high-quality, therefore DC Power Supply System is requested for high-quality too. In high-quality DC power systems, the exiting DC protection devices, such as the fuse and the Molded Case Circuit Breaker MCCB).But they cannot turn off quickly and stable circuit breaking. Therefore we developed a semiconductor switch that uses a Metal Oxide Semiconductor-Field Effect Transistor (MOS-FET) as a new DC protection device. We present the characteristics for breaking a DC circuit in short circuit when a semiconductor switch is used as protection device on Power supply system and the solutions for short circuit breaking.
